National Institute of Technology Mizoram was established in 2010 and is located in Aizawl, Mizoram. It is a reputed technical institution, known for its focus on engineering education. The institute has been ranked 101-150 by NIRF 2024 under the Engineering category, and also achieved Band-Promising by ARIIA 2021 under the Overall category. The college maintains an MoU with IIT Madras for academic and research activities, and provides placement assistance to students seeking career opportunities. NITMZ (an Institute of National Importance) offers UG, PG, and PhD courses to students, with a total of 37 courses available. These programs are provided across 9 departments. National Institute of Technology Mizoram has been recognised by the Government of India as an Institute of National Importance. Further, NIT Mizoram provides Bachelor of Technology (B.Tech), Master of Technology (M.Tech), and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) programs as flagship courses, with B.Tech offering 60 seats per specialization and M.Tech 18 seats per specialization. The curriculum focuses on Engineering, Science, & Humanities. The institute is situated on a sprawling 190.35-acre campus in Aizawl, and is equipped with modern facilities. NIT Mizoram is committed to fostering technological advancement and overall student development, accommodating 516 total students. The institute also boasts 24 faculty members dedicated to academic excellence. National Institute of Technology Mizoram is driven and promoted by the Government of India. Located in Aizawl, this reputed technical college accepts JEE Main and GATE scores for various admissions, and conducts its own written test and interviews for specific postgraduate and doctoral programs.
